Nehemiah’s prayer is a powerful reminder that God’s covenant with Israel wasn't just about blessings, but also about consequences. He reminds God of the specific warning given through Moses: disobedience leads to scattering among the nations.
The Nature of God's Judgment
This isn't arbitrary punishment. It’s a consequence woven into the very fabric of the covenant. When God’s people turn away from Him, they not only break their commitment but also sever the very connection that provides protection and prosperity. Scattering is the natural outcome of breaking covenant – like separating a flock from its shepherd.
A Father's Discipline
While 'scatter' sounds harsh, it’s crucial to remember that even this judgment is rooted in God's enduring love and desire for His people to return. It’s a difficult, painful lesson designed to bring them back to their senses and back to Him.
